Cell Bodies
The part of a neuron that contains the nucleus and most of the cytoplasm and organelles, responsible for the cell's metabolic activities.
Dendrites
Extensions of a neuron that receive signals from other neurons and conduct them toward the cell body.
Nerve Fibers
Extensions of nerve cells that transmit electrical impulses between different parts of the body, essential for communication within the nervous system.
Glial Cell
Cells within the central and peripheral nervous system that are not neurons, which serve to support and safeguard neuronal cells.
